Farmers' Council invites milk producers to a seminar in Rēzekne

The Association "Farmers' Council" in cooperation with the State Rural Network and JSC "Dimela Veta Latvija" organizes and invites milk producers to the seminar "Opportunities and things to do in dairy farming in crisis conditions", which will take place this year on November 21 in Rēzekne, in the Rēzekne Municipality Assembly Hall, Atbrīvošanas aleja 95A. The seminar starts at 10:00.

At the seminar, Vita Būde – Gaile, a representative of JSC “Dimela Veta Latvija”, will inform about how to act in a milk crisis situation in order to maintain the viability of the farm. Specialists for milk producers will tell what can be done in a dairy farm at the moment and what definitely cannot. The attendees will also be introduced to the actions of German farmers in a crisis situation, when the cost price exceeds the price of milk, and other topical issues.

In turn, the management of the association "Farmers' Council" will inform about support payments to farmers (direct payments, greening and state support), planned support measures in agricultural enterprises, as well as current changes in regulatory enactments (Protection Zones Law, Hunting Law, etc.).

The seminar will be attended by the management of the association "Farmers' Council" and JSC "Dimela Veta Latvija" Lead Animal Welfare Specialist and Dairy Farm Auditor Dr. Vita Būde – Rooster.
